Output 44c4be81c780938291f6c351e9d1c5c6f5e1466df91155660dcf91edb9598045:0

value
584611555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 914c33115cf08beaa653e10ecbf3ff7397bd09b1 OP_EQUAL
address
3EwHBntudc5fq9NchSMGmTz2vbJDiKsPT5
transaction
44c4be81c780938291f6c351e9d1c5c6f5e1466df91155660dcf91edb9598045
spent
true